Three men have been arrested after a quantity of Class B drugs were found on during a proactive vehicle stop.
Officers were patrolling on Bramtoco Way, in the early hours of Saturday 17 June, when at around 12.05am they conducted a proactive search under Section 23 of the Misuse of Drugs Act.
A 19-year-old man from Coventry was subsequently arrested on suspicion of possession of a Class B drug and possession of a Class B drug with intent to supply. He was issued with a conditional caution.
While an 18-year-old man from Dorset and a 17-year-old man from Brockenhurst were both arrested on suspicion of possession of a Class B drug with intent to supply. They were both released with no further action taken.
